汇编笔记7

1字=2个字节,一个16位寄存器储存一个字,其中高8位储存高字节,低8位储存低字节。

图片发自简书App

上图中,0字节单元和1字节单元构成了一个字单元,其中1字节单元存储高位字节,0字节单元存储低位字节。


     8086CPU中的寄存器

通用寄存器:AX,BX,CX,DX,SP,BP,SI,DI。

指令寄存器:IP

标志寄存器:FR

段寄存器:CS,DS,ES,SS。


                   mov指令

mov指令用于实现寄存器和内存单元间的数据交互。

数据直接传入寄存器

mov ax,1000H

注意:数据不能直接传入段寄存器,需要先经过一般寄存器中转。

数据传入DS寄存器

mov ax,1000H
mov ds,ax


数据从寄存器bx到寄存器ax。

mov ax,bx

数据从寄存器ax到地址为1000H,偏移地址为0的内存单元(段)

mov bx,1000H
mov ds,bx
mov [0],ax

上面的过程,反一下

mov bx,1000H
mov ds,bx
mov ax,[0]
最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• 8086汇编 本笔记是笔者观看小甲鱼老师(鱼C论坛)《零基础入门学习汇编语言》系列视频的笔记,在此感谢他和像他一样...
    Gibbs基阅读 37,492评论 8 114
  • 计算机通过执行指令序列来使机器得以工作,所以对于每一系列的计算机都有指定的一组指令集供计算机使用,这组指令...
    未来科技工作室阅读 8,175评论 1 10
  • 王爽汇编全书知识点大纲 第一章 基础知识 机器语言 汇编语言的产生 汇编语言的组成 存储器 cpu对存储器的读写 ...
    2c3ba901516f阅读 2,462评论 0 1
  • 清早醒来看见弯给我暗搓搓的饺子点了赞,开心得翻了个身睡完回笼觉给他发新年快乐。 昨晚吃完饺子在公车站同学问伯尔尼怎...
    Lebkuchen阅读 121评论 0 1
  • 我家有个院子。我们家的小狗也在这里生活着,它是一只哈士奇。 经常有野猫来到我们的大树上爬来爬去。我就跟...
    一颗麦稻阅读 298评论 1 7